Synonyms of: Juicing
Juicing, a popular method of extracting liquid from fruits and vegetables, has several synonyms that reflect its essence and benefits. One of the most common synonyms is “extracting,” which emphasizes the process of obtaining juice from produce. This term encapsulates the idea of drawing out the nutritious liquid while discarding the solid remnants, making it a fitting alternative for those discussing the juicing process.
Pressing
Another synonym for juicing is “pressing.” This term is often used in the context of cold-pressed juices, where fruits and vegetables are crushed and pressed to release their juices without the application of heat. Pressing highlights the technique used to obtain juice, focusing on the method that preserves the nutrients and flavors of the ingredients, appealing to health-conscious consumers.
